What is Revit?
Revit is a BIM (building information modelling) software that creates intelligent 3D models of buildings which can be used to produce construction documentation drawings and design presentations. Revit is a building-specific solution for design and documentation and is currently the industry’s leading software for BIM. Revit is used for conceptual design, 3D parametric modelling, detailed design documentation, multi-discipline coordination, modelling building components, analysing and simulating systems and structures, iterating and visualising architectural designs, building performance analysis and more.
Why learn Revit?
Revit not only allows architects to design and model 3D solutions, but the BIM software also allows for seamless collaboration between disciplines which makes working with structural engineers, other designers, and MEP consultants incredibly efficient.

Hi Kyle I have used the same door type in my project. Is there anyway of annotating them all as DT01 at once or do I have to change them manually
@kylesinko
@kylesinko Год назад
You can change their Family "Type Mark" value and tag that. This will show each same door as the same tag. But for instance-based tags you will need to change each mark individually. This is because each door would be considered a unique door in a Door Schedule. I hope that makes sense
